Notice of Scholarship opportunity for Women in STEM

Deadline Nears for Mwalimu Nyerere African Union Scheme for Female Applicants Only

If you are a female student from any African country interested in pursuing graduate studies in Science, Technology and Mathematics (STEM), you have less than 30 days to apply for sponsorship under the 2018 African Union Mwalimu Nyerere Scholarships Scheme for females only.

Description of the overall project

The offered positions are part of the Horizon 2020 Science with and for Society project “SCALINGS – Scaling up Co-creation: Avenues and Limits for Integrating Society in Science and Innovation”. This is a joint program of the Philosophy and Ethics group at TU/e, together with 8 other universities across Europe as Technical University Munich, Technical University Denmark, Mines Paris Tech, ESADE Spain and University College London.

 

Co-creation practice – and co-creation research – are at a crossroads: More than ever, initiatives to boost innovation through collaboration among diverse actors are flourishing across Europe. Yet, this mainstreaming poses new challenges to better understand “co-creation processes and outcomes under various cultural, societal and regulatory backgrounds to allow better-targeted policy support” (SwafS-13-17). To date, no systematic studies exist that detail how co-creation instruments operate under different socio-cultural conditions, i.e. if “best practices” will be effective elsewhere or if the resulting products and services are compatible with new markets.

SCALINGS addresses the challenge of mainstreaming co-creation across a diverse Europe head-on: In the first ever rigorous comparative study, we will investigate the implementation, uptake, and outcomes of three co-creation instruments (public procurement of innovation, co-creation facilities, and living labs) in two technical domains (robotics and urban energy) across 10 countries. Using comparative case studies and coordinated cross-country experiments, we explore if and how these instruments can be generalized, transferred, or scaled up to new socio-cultural, economic, or institutional conditions to unleash their innovative power.

Based on this unique data set, we will develop two new transformative frameworks – “situated co-creation” and “socially robust scaling” – to guide the wider dissemination of co-creation. We will synthesize our findings into an “EU Policy Roadmap” to support ongoing EU innovation policy efforts. Empirically, SCALINGS is closely integrated with over two dozen European co-creation initiatives that deal with cross-cultural transferability on a daily basis. Together with these partners, we will co-create enhanced practices that feed directly back into their work and strategy. Finally, we will launch a training program (boot camp) on co-creation in diverse settings for other EU consortia.

Call for DAAD scholarship

 DAAD SCHOLARSHIP APPLICATION PROCEDURE FOR UNIVERSITY OF NIGERIA

Candidates who wish to apply for DAAD In-Country/In-Region Scholarship Must first be admitted into University of Nigeria. Application procedure for admission for those wishing to apply for the DAAD Scholarship has been simplified as follows.

 

The Candidates should submit the following documents via email:

  1. Completed application form
  2. Curriculum vitae
  3. Academic Certificates or Statements of Result *
  4. Academic Transcripts *
  5. Brief description of the intended Research (Research proposal – maximum two pages).
  6. Two Referee reports from your University and/or Employer

 

 

  • * For those applying for M.Sc. programme, only the Bachelor’s degree Certificate and Transcripts are required. However, for those apply for Ph.D. Programme BOTH Bachelor’s and Masters Degree certificates and Transcripts are required.
